I remember a time
when we danced
loved and laughed.
We were brighter
than our sister moon
and the stars.
Brother wind
continued to blow
and . . .
Father Sun
kept us warm.
In the garden
we were gods.
We were
a part of the all;
every tree
a part of you
a part of me.
The energy of every living thing
had tales to tell and songs to sing.
The trees knew that we
had need of shade.
They sprouted leaves
to cover us, while
lying naked in the plush
green grass’ blades.
The time was magical.
Communication . . .
with every being
was a possibility.
The waters raised
to greet us
with an invitation
to drink.
To join in with them.
And let their glorious
waves hold you and me.
Speak to me
oh waters of the deep.
Tell me about my brother
the giant squid.
With his large brain
and naked body
that stiffens
by an interior
cartilaginous skeleton.
He loves to swim and play. And
Stick to the sides of his friends
with those powerful suction cups.
Let me stay here forever
do not let me sleep.
In this garden now
is where I belong.
Alas, we did sleep
it swept across us
like a hazy day.
We forgot where
we came from.
Now, lessons had to be learned;
to maneuver through
this world
this life.
Let me remember again
ahhh, I am waking.
I remember this now;
there is no time
. . . no space
while we dance
love and laugh.
We are brighter than
our sister moon
and the stars.
Brother wind
continues to blow
and . . .
Father Sun
keeps us warm.
I AM here
in the Garden
once more.
Selah
